Vicunas are known as the "bearers of the golden fleece." The Vicuna fiber is the rarest and finest hair fiber in the world. It is lighter, softer and warmer than any other hair fiber. The Vicuna fiber, which is sensitive to chemical processing, is left in its natural color, a spicy cinnamon.

About this product: The precious Vicunas live only in the upper altitudes of the Andes Mountains at elevations between 12,000 and 18,000 feet. Each animal produces only about 4 ounces of harvestable fiber each year. Previously hunted nearly to extinction, conservation programs have rescued this shy and graceful animal. Though still considered endangered, in 2002 the United States government allowed importation of Vicuna garments from Peru. The garments carried with them certification that the fiber was legally obtained through a government sanctioned chacu, the process by which Vicunas are rounded up, sheared alive and then returned to the wild. Once sheared, the animals cannot be sheared again for at least two years. Vicuna yarn from Jacques Cartier carries this certification.
Vicuna is often woven into material for luxury apparel and home fashions. Vicuna fabric can range from $1,800 to $3,000 per yard. One ball of this precious fiber will create a lovely lacy accessory.
